Abhijnanashakuntalam: The Recognition of Shakuntala

Description: Abhijnanashakuntalam: The Recognition of Shakuntala is a Sanskrit play written by Kalidasa. It is one of the most famous and widely performed plays in Indian literature. The play tells the story of Shakuntala, a young woman who is abandoned by her lover, King Dushyanta, and later reunited with him after many years.
